At the heart of this Seiko watch beats the calibre 2620, a high-end analog quartz movement produced by the manufacture in the 1980s, also found in prestigious models such as Credor. Precise and finely made, it offers a true “set and forget” operation. A quartz watch delivers greater accuracy than most mechanical watches: a simple battery is enough to power it for years, with no mechanical servicing required.

What is a guilloché dial?
Guilloché is a decorative pattern engraved or stamped into the dial — here a fine grid known as « clous de Paris ». It catches the light and brings depth and relief to the champagne dial, a refined finish found on quality dress watches.
